A car bought out of necessity rather than want should not be this good. It just shouldn't!



I bought the ZT CDTi by chance. I drive a Mid Engine Sports car but as we all know fast cars cost a lot to run and are not the most user friendly everyday run around. When I initially bought the ZT I was searching for small Euro hatch, something Golf like with a sensible 1.9 Diesel engine. Instead, out of a moment of what could be seen as many as insanity I arrive home not with the Euro Box but a Bright Blue Brutish British Saloon.. In retrospect it is quite possibly the best motoring decision I have made to date.



Parking up next to a BMW 3 Series or Jaguar X-Type it feels like a step above in terms of design with the retro lines of the Rover 75 mixing it up with the brawn of MG kit to create something that at no angle looks boring or staid while never venturing into the realms of being vulgar or "in your face". Its the same story inside with the ties with BMW really shining through in the efficiency of the switchgear and the high quality of the materials making the cabin a really nice place to be. My only qualm with the interior is that by 2009 standards the rear is starting to show its age in regards to lack of space and I have taken this into account in my star rating.



The final point is the driving. This is what blew me away. Even without the nice cabin, without the exterior charm the ZT would remain a cracking car to drive. I really never expected this and comparing with the likes of a Vauxhall Vectra or even an Audi A4 the car is leagues ahead. Applause to MG Engineers!



The car could handle a lot more power... Which, thankfully MG addressed... I know in the future I will be buying a ZT V8 and as a prologue to that car, the ZT CDTi is near faultless..



...And for a Diesel Family Saloon that is indeed high praise!
